Also habe ich 2 Nächte mit diesem Code gearbeitet, den ich von meinem Lehrer bekommen habe. Ich habe versucht, ein paar gute Javadoc auf JOGL ohne viel Erfolg zu finden. Also habe ich die try/fail-Methode benutzt, um die Variablen hier und da zu ändern. Ich habe gelernt, wie man Rotation, Entfernung und Größe steuert. Also habe ich mir ein kleines "Sonnensystem" gemacht - aber hier kommt mein Problem - wie kann ich mehrere Texturen für die verschiedenen Planeten, die ich gemacht habe, umsetzen? Heres mein Code:Benötigen Sie Hilfe beim Hinzufügen verschiedener Texturen zu verschiedenen Objekten in JOGL

Sie müssen die richtige Textur binden ('gl.glBindTexture'), bevor Sie den Planeten zeichnen (' gl.glDrawElements'). – Rabbid76

Sie benötigen ein Texturobjekt für jede Textur. Dazu müssen Sie einen Container mit der richtigen Größe erstellen.

private IntBuffer textureNames = GLBuffers.newDirectIntBuffer(noOfTextures); 

und Sie haben die Textur-Objekte zu erstellen, und Sie müssen die Texturen laden:

gl.glGenTextures(noOfTextures , textureNames); 

for (int i=0; i<noOfTextures; i++) { 

    TextureData textureData = TextureIO.newTextureData(glProfile, 
     new File(textureFilename[i]), false, TextureIO.JPG); 

    gl.glBindTexture(gl.GL_TEXTURE_2D, textureNames.get(i)); 

    gl.glTexImage2D(.....);  

    ..... 
} 

Schließlich haben Sie Recht, die richtige Textur zu binden, bevor Sie das Netz ziehen:

gl.glBindTexture(gl.GL_TEXTURE_2D, textureNames.get(texture_index1)); 
gl.glDrawElements(.....); 

..... 

gl.glBindTexture(gl.GL_TEXTURE_2D, textureNames.get(texture_index2)); 
gl.glDrawElements(.....); 

Beachten Sie die Anzahl der generierten Texturen, wenn Sie sie löschen:

gl.glDeleteTextures(noOfTextures , textureNames);

Okay, jetzt habe ich es! Sie müssen gl.glBindTexture (gl.GL_TEXTURE_2D, textureNames.get (texture_index)); zwischen den Zeichnungen, so dass Sie eine Textur auswählen, zeichnen, neue Textur auswählen und dann erneut zeichnen. Vielen Dank für deine Hilfe! –
